What happened

Daily trading volumes for the XDC token have dropped sharply since August 2025. A year ago, volumes were usually between $25 million and $50 million, with a peak, but now they have collapsed, according to data from @artemis.

Global impact / market context

Lower trading volume often means fewer buyers and sellers, which can make the token's price more volatile and harder to trade. This could reduce investor interest and affect the XDC Network's ability to attract users and funding.

Analyst inference

Cryptocurrency markets are sensitive to trading activity. A sustained decline in volume might signal fading demand or increased caution among traders. This could pressure the token's price and potentially impact the broader network's adoption and ecosystem growth.
